Secret Distinctions In Between Payment Bonds and Mechanic's Liens



When determining between payment bonds and technician's liens, it's important to recognize the crucial distinctions to make an enlightened selection. Payment bonds are generally obtained by the project proprietor to make certain that subcontractors and suppliers are paid for the job they've finished. On the other hand, technician's liens are a lawful claim versus the residential property by a contractor, subcontractor, or supplier who hasn't been spent for job done on that particular residential or commercial property.

Repayment bonds offer protection to subcontractors and vendors if the basic specialist fails to pay as assured. In contrast, technician's liens supply a way for professionals and distributors to safeguard payment by positioning an insurance claim on the building where the work was performed. Payment bonds are usually acquired before work starts, while technician's liens are submitted after non-payment problems develop.
